New Parlophone, Warner Bros. Staff Unveiled By Mark Poston

24 February 2014 | 2:55 pm | Staff Writer

MD announces teams

Returning Australian music executive Mark Poston has unveiled his new team for Parlophone and Warner Bros. Records a month after his appointment at Warner was confirmed.

The Managing Director for the two entities in Australia has appointed festival sponsorships guru Simon Cahill (starting March 24) as Head Of Marketing & Brand Development for Parlophone and Warner Bros. as he looks to build both brands in Australia under the Warner Group banner.

In an email to theMusic.com.au Poston also confirmed that Zoe Bartlett (starting March 10) returns to the group as Marketing Manager, having most recently been triple j/Alternative Music Manager at ABC Music. Laura Byrne, who has been with Warner for the past five years, also becomes Marketing Manager for the labels, as does Di Vidovic, who follows Poston to Warner from EMI.

Leah Harris has started today as Executive Assistant to the Managing Director of Parlophone and Warner Bros., moving over from Apple where she was assistant to the local iTunes hierarchy. Also starting today in an iTunes-switch is Linda-Jane Vanhear, who takes up the role of Marketing Coordinator.

Adrian Fitz-Alan is working with the team in a consulting and advisory role in regards to business and legal affairs.

Poston confirmed his expected role at Warner in January, almost exactly a year after he was the highest-profile casualty of Universal's purchase of EMI.
